Chapter 1: The Village of the Midnight Sun

The town of Snowman is near the North Pole and has very long days and nights. A girl named Ana seems to be picking up psychic images from someone unknown. This person beats up zombies, possessed lamps, and crazed animals in the images. Ana has powers, including healing and telekinesis, but she can't fully control them. From the images she's seen, they seem to be coming from a boy about her age. The boy, named Ken, meets up with a weaker boy named Lloyd. The two boys argue a bit, then comment that they're on a journey to save the Earth. Ana comments that she'd yell at them if she were there, then goes to get a glass of water. Ana's father is a minister, and her mother vanished without a trace a month ago. All kinds of crazy disasters and abductions have been taking place around the world lately. Ana's father prays to God for someone to come and save them all. Ana decides it's her destiny to help her mom and those boys, and asks God to use her as He sees fit. Just then, two boys burst into the church to return a hat that Ana lost at the train station. Ana says she knows who they are, then introduces herself and says that she's going with them. Her father asks what they're traveling for, and they answer that they're out to save the world. Ken is glad Ana's actually pretty hot, but Ana reads his thoughts and smacks him hard. Ana goes and changes clothes before leaving. |
Chapter 2: Warriors

The three kids walk through the snow to the train station, but Ken suddenly stops. They're suddenly attacked from all directions and Ana winds up on the ground, helpless. Wolves attack Ana before she can get up and hide. Ken calmly saves her in the nick of time, and the wolves run off. Ana gets upset after seeing that a wolf had ripped her carefully-managed hair. Lloyd is polite, asks if she needs any medical treatment, then helps her get up. Lloyd talks to Ana about how Ken used to be mean to him too when they first met. Ana thanks Lloyd for cheering her up, which makes him shy and embarrassed. Ken comes back and yells at them to get moving already. The train only goes to the nearby town of Halloween, which really pisses Ken off. Lloyd and Ana talk about Lloyd's home town of Thanksgiving. Ken tells Ana she's a burden and should probably go back home at the next station. He says Halloween's going to be dangerous; the station attendants were acting suspicious. They arrive at Halloween only to learn that no trains can leave for at least 2 or 3 days. Ana says she'll be staying with them after all, and Ken angrily concedes. Ken says he needs to call his dad, which Ana finds amusing, so he angrily explains. Ken mentions that he calls his dad every so often to get the very latest news about things. Ana asks about Lloyd's family, which creates some awkwardness. Lloyd starts to get upset as he talks more about himself. Ana feels bad because he's just like his father and his mother is gravely ill. Ana mentions how the two of them are alike - they're both out to save their mothers. Lloyd kisses Ana. Ken shows up and gets pissed because they're slacking again. They suddenly see enemies everywhere. Ken heard about a haunted house that has eerie piano music coming out of it. A grouchy man and a crazy lady verbally assault the group. More attacks ensue, and the party finds itself on the verge of defeat. Ana uses a special spray can to return all the enemies to their senses. Ana is shocked when Ken uses PK Healing on Lloyd. She's very impressed, even though she's much more proficient at using it. Lloyd is healed and gets back up. They all start walking again. |
Chapter 3: The Haunted House

The group is in front of the haunted house, though they question its haunted-ness. Ana hasn't slept in a long time and she grouchily asks what they're doing there. Lloyd explains that they're collecting melodies and that the piano inside might have one. Ana asks them to explain everything from the very beginning. Crazy things happened one day, and Ken's father explained that an alien had come to Earth. Ken found his great-grandfather's diary, which explained how to get to the land of Magicant. Queen Mary of Magicant can get rid of the evildoers if she can remember a special melody. Ana is naturally good at music and figures that's why she was put on this journey. Ana suddenly agrees to go inside, but Ken stops her because he needs food. Mr. Rosewater, owner of the mansion, feeds them a big dinner at his own house. He asks them to get rid of the ghosts and turn the mansion back to normal. He explains that it's supposed to be a pure place for his daughter to live until she marries. Lloyd asks for the key to the place, but Mr. Rosewater laughs for some reason. Mr. Rosewater starts acting creepy and secretly tells Lloyd things while Ken falls asleep. Ana can't believe she's traveling with a loser like Ken, or that the world's fate is in his hands. Ana has mixed feelings when she notices Mr. Rosewater's daughter shyly staring at Ken. Ana is distraught that the family's servant cut her hair so short. She wants to pick flowers for her hair, but decides not to since all life is already in danger. Ken is pissed because Lloyd signed a contract that said Ken has to get engaged with someone. Rosewater saw that his daughter liked Ken and decided to only give the key if they got engaged. Ken argues like crazy and yells at the other two a lot. He blames them and accuses them of conspiring against him so they can be together. Ana double-slaps Ken and suddenly all is quiet. They return to the haunted house and use the key to enter. The mansion is very dark and spooky. They don't know where to go when suddenly an evil rat starts laughing at them. Ana uses her powers to ask the rat where the piano is, but it says to go look on their own. It and other rats suddenly attack her, aiming for her throat, but the two boys repel them. LOTS more rats appear and start to overwhelm the group, especially Ana. They manage to knock Ana to the ground and temporarily blind her, leaving her helpless. She passes out briefly, but Ken picks her up and carries her as they run through the house. Ana is filled with conflicing emotions as Ken continues to carry her as the boys run and fight. They get completely lost. Ken puts Ana down as two suits of armor come down the stairs and a ghost comes up. Ken apologizes for always being a jerk while Lloyd tries in vain to kill the ghost. Ken gets his bat knocked out of his hands and suddenly has an asthma attack. Lloyd fares no better, and Ana is curled up crying and wishing it was all a dream. Lloyd is about to be defeated and all Ana can do is look on. Suddenly, a bright light comes out of Ana and vanquishes all the enemies. The boys are surprised to learn that she has even stronger PSI than Ken. Ana is also surprised by what happened. She realizes that now she'll be protecting THEM, which confuses her and makes her cry. Ken and Ana wind up hugging, but Ken is embarrassed and says something to make her mad. The group finally finds the piano room, and a melody plays on the piano all by itself. Ken suggests that they not return to Rosewater's place, but the other two think that's mean. Rosewater is convinced by his daughter to call the engagement thing off. She had changed her mind when her mirror broke while she was sewing a cape for Ken. The three kids rip up the contract as they hurry to the train station. |
Chapter 4: In the Desert

The three trek through the vast and empty desert. A famous guidebook says it's a super dangerous desert, but none of them ever read it. They're on their way to Holy Roly Mountain. They're having a hard time, but the desert's especially taking its toll on Lloyd. Lloyd faints. Ken takes out some sports drinks (not Pocari Sweat ;) ) from his backpack. They wish that the train still went through the desert. Ana tries to cool Lloyd off while she gets all philosophical about the desert. Suddenly she hears a baby shouting her name from far off, but passes it off as a mirage. Ken suddenly spots some UFOs in the distance, and they're coming in their direction. They hide in the sand, Lloyd wakes up, and then they notice a scorpion. The scorpion is right by Lloyd's ear, so Ana uses telepathy to tell it not to attack. The scorpion is lulled into a calm state while Lloyd safely gets away. Just then, Ken triumphantly smashes the scorpion away, and Ana gets really, really mad. Ken and Ana yell at each other angrily. They continue to bicker, but Lloyd reminds them they need to hide from the UFOs. They watch the UFOs pass by. Ana realizes they're headed for the big city of Thanksgiving. They continue to watch the big UFO group, and then notice an old plane trying to keep up. Ken gets very excited when he sees the kind of plane it is, as he's a fan of war stuff. The others are like, "O...K..." and the plane's history is described in great detail. The plane starts to sputter and fall, but uprights itself at the very last second. The plane goes to make an emergency landing... right on top of them! They freak out and run. Ana freaks because her life should be passing before her eyes, but it doesn't. Lloyd faints again. Ana opens her eyes. The plane had stopped 3 cm from Ken's nose. Ken faints. An old man comes out of the cockpit and asks if he ran the boy over. All four fly to the old man's secret base. They chat over dinner. Ken calls his dad. Lloyd asks to borrow his plane. The man is surprised. They explain everything to him. The man says he can't let them use the plane, but he can take them wherever they want. Ken suggests Holy Roly Mountain, but Ana reminds them they don't have the full song yet. The old man leads them through some old ruins to try to find a "Singing Cactus". |

ABOUT THE AUTHOR - Saori Kumi was born April 30, 1959 in Iwate Prefecture of Japan. She has written a lot of science fiction novels and novels based on games. Such games include Mother 1, Mother 2, Dragon Quest IV, and Dragon Quest VI.
